Trastevere means "beyond the river" and it is considered one of the most typical disctrict of Rome. Along this 2.5-hour tour you not only will discover Trastevere and its cosy alleys and hidden corners, but will sample the typical Italian and Roman street food. You will discover district's landmark such as the church of Santa Maria in Trastevere, risen around the first Christian community in Rome, Sistus Bridge, named after the pope who commissioned its restoration in 16th century, or Piazza Trilussa, dedicated to one of the most famous Roman dialect poet. Meet your guide on Tiber Island, the only urban island of the Tiber river and learn the this small island shaped like a ship. Start the tour in the medieval side of Trastevere. Your guide will take you to the Church of Santa Cecilia, the patron saint of musicians, and your first stop will be in one of Rome's oldest bakeries.

Trastevere remains very traditional and boasts the presence of many old-school craftsmen and traders. Discover their  work, unchanged by modernity, like the cold cuts store where you can taste salami and cheese cured in the local Italian tradition.

Then, move to the heart of the district, in piazza di Santa Maria in Trastevere. After visiting the homonym church, tasting will continue with one of the most famous typical Roman Street food: the supplì, a deep fried rice ball filled with cheese, tomato mozzarella egg. From one stop to another you will also discover one of the oldest and best pizza shop of the district. 

Your guide will show you the off-the beaten paths of this area, and help you to familiarize with the area, full of restaurants of local cooking or bar and pub where young locals use to spend their night having fun with friends. Not only salty tastings, but also sweets!
